FIJI

Introduce yourself with a handshake and a smile. A drink of kava may be offered as a sign of goodwill, refusal to drink it may be taken as a discourtesy.

Silence is seen as part of social interaction and pauses in conversation are seen as friendly, not awkwardness. At meals, it is usually the guest of honour to offer a toast following the meal.

FRANCE

The French are proud of their culture and expect visitors to have some knowledge and appreciation of the French culture. Table manners are considered important.
